### Ticket: Tighten canary gating on Pondwright

Right now the canary for Pondwright promotes after 10 minutes regardless of error deltas — not great. Proposal: block promotion if p95 latency regresses >5% or error rate doubles vs. baseline. Config lives in `gatekeeper/rules.yml`. Future maintainers: don't loosen these without a recorded reason. Needs sign-off from the owner named below.

named custodian: Oliath Ralax

MEMO — Kettling Depot Receiving

Uniform sets for the new Kettling depot arrive Wednesday via Ashgrove courier: 40 boxes, sorted by size, manifest attached to box one. Check the count at the dock before signing; shortages go straight to stores, not the courier. The hand-over instruction the courier will follow is set out below.

drop instructions, tafof-baguf: the holmir gilox courier leaves the sormir ulaok holdor ledger at gate 5596 under passcode 257343

## Build Provenance — ChipGate Reader Firmware

Every firmware image for the Lorrick Mile timing-chip readers is built from a tagged commit on the release branch, signed by the Wrenfold pipeline, and archived with its full dependency manifest. Never flash an image pulled from a developer workstation; race-day failures at the Haleborough Marathon traced back to exactly that. To verify an installed image, compare the mat controller's reported token against the value below.

pipeline stamp: htk9_6ce9d33c5

To the heads of department: as I pass responsibilities to Imogen Farrell, the outstanding item is the Kestrel House franchise agreement. Negotiations with the Brindlemere group are at the term-sheet stage; royalty percentages and territory boundaries remain unsettled. Legal has flagged the exclusivity clause for revision, and the operations team should prepare staffing estimates regardless of outcome. Imogen will convene a review in her second week. The commercial reasoning behind our position appears in the confidential note below.

board note of bawep-tajef: Queniusek Systems plans to raise the Quenvan list price by 53.1 percent in March. The pricing group signed off on a budget of $176.4 million for Project Drueth. The renewal with Casionix Partners closes at $142.5 million a year, 8.3 percent below the last contract. Project Fraax slips by six weeks because of the tooling delay.